ADMIN ASSISTANT
We are recruiting on behalf of a global financial services organisation for an Admin Assistant to support its Data Engineering function. This role involves managing a range of central operational and administrative activities, ensuring the smooth running of a highly technical and fast-paced team.

The Data Engineering team is responsible for delivering secure, scalable, and high-quality data across the organisation, including building and maintaining central data platforms and supporting data governance. You will work closely with internal teams to support coordination, organisation, and efficient day-to-day operations within this critical function.

ADMIN ASSISTANT ROLE:
  • Managing onboarding and off-boarding of employees and contingent workers using WAND
  • Raising RM and contingent worker requests
  • Initiating transfers and completing follow-ups for inter- and intra-department moves
  • Maintaining and cleansing the RMS tree through weekly data issue clean-ups
  • Managing Cyborg access and administration
  • Supporting hiring efforts by coordinating FTE and contingent worker onboarding requirements, including background check follow-ups
  • Monitoring programme and project hygiene to ensure data accuracy and compliance
  • Validating Artemis time booking entries
  • Overseeing quarterly Business Continuity Plan certification processes
ADMIN ASSISTANT ESSENTIALS:
  • Bringing two to three years of experience within the financial services industry, preferably in an analytical role
  • Demonstrating strong stakeholder and relationship management skills
  • Communicating effectively with strong listening, written, and verbal skills
  • Maintaining exceptional attention to detail across all work
  • Managing multiple time-sensitive projects while maintaining a high quality of delivery
  • Applying critical and analytical thinking with sound judgement and a thoughtful approach to decision-making
  • Demonstrating advanced capability in Microsoft Office products, particularly Excel and PowerPoint, for business use
  • Working in a results-oriented and proactive manner
  • Solving problems effectively through strong analytical and reasoning skills
